What is a Composite Front Door?
Composite front doors are constructed utilizing a mix of materials, mostly PVC, wood, and insulating foam. This multi-material style results in doors that exceed standard wood or steel options in different ways, such as energy performance, security, and maintenance.
Structure of Composite Front Doors:P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ride): A durable product that assists withstand weather conditions and physical damage.Wood: Often used for aesthetic functions, it brings warmth however is less prone to rot and warping than standard wooden doors.Insulating Foam: Provides thermal insulation, making composite doors energy-efficient.Glass Reinforcement: Many styles consist of fiberglass or glazed elements for both security and aesthetic appeal.Benefits of Composite Front Doors

The length of time do composite front doors last?
Composite front doors can last anywhere from 25 to thirty years, especially with correct maintenance.
2. Are composite doors more energy-efficient than wood doors?
Yes, composite doors usually use better insulation properties, resulting in lower energy costs.
3. Can I repaint my composite front door?
While it's possible to repaint a composite Custom Door Installation, it is vital to use the ideal kind of paint and follow the manufacturer's guidelines to avoid voiding the warranty.
4. How do I keep my composite front door?
Routine cleansing with mild soap and water is generally sufficient. It's advisable to inspect hinges and seals regularly to ensure they stay in good condition.
5. Are composite front doors weatherproof?
Yes, they are created to stand up to extreme weather, making them highly weather-resistant.
